Bradley J. Brennan is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Bradley J. Brennan has authored 22 papers receiving a total of 849 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 16 papers in Materials Chemistry, 12 papers in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ment and 5 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Bradley J. Brennan’s work include Porphyrin and Phthalocyanine Chemistry (11 papers), Advanced Photocatalysis Techniques (7 papers) and TiO2 Photocatalysis and Solar Cells (7 papers). Bradley J. Brennan is often cited by papers focused on Porphyrin and Phthalocyanine Chemistry (11 papers), Advanced Photocatalysis Techniques (7 papers) and TiO2 Photocatalysis and Solar Cells (7 papers). Bradley J. Brennan collaborates with scholars based in United States, Argentina and Saudi Arabia. Bradley J. Brennan's co-authors include Gary W. Brudvig, Devens Gust, Thomas A. Moore, Paul A. Liddell, Ana L. Moore, Karin J. Young, R. Tagore, Kelly L. Materna, Robert H. Crabtree and Manuel J. Llansola‐Portoles and has published in prestigious journals such as Accounts of Chemical Research, The Journal of Physical Chemistry B and Chemical Communications.
